Summary
1939-45 Star medal awarded to Mjr. William Edward Ball, service number VX 150043, for service in World War II.
Part of Medal Group awarded to Major Ball that includes: 1939-1945 Star, The Pacific Star, War Medal 1939-45, Australia Service Medal. Mounted on bar with pin.
The 1939-45 Star was awarded by the British Commonwealth for service in the Second World War. Medal recipient's were required to have undertaken operational service between 3 September 1939 and 2 September 1945.
Physical Description
A six pointed bronze star with loop and attached ribbon from top. The obverse features, below a crown, the Royal cypher GRI above VI (Translation- George VI King and Emperor); around THE 1939 - 1945 STAR. The reverse is Impressed VX 150043 W.E. BALL
